Over 140 people turned out for the opening day of the River Helmsdale. Stormy weather saw many anglers finish early, however some hardy souls lasted until last light in search of that first fresh fish of the season. Unfortunately for those who braved the weather, the fish were the winners on the day. Apart from a couple of caught,then returned Kelts, most anglers went home empty handed, although an enjoyable day was had all round.
Ronald from the Helmsdale tackle shop told UK flyfisher " It is all up for grabs tomorrow, maybe someone will catch one then ".
